Data Conversion
Hundreds of ResourceMateŽ customers
have had us convert their existing data into ResourceMateŽ format. The
cost ranges from $60 to $240, depending on the complexity and format of
your data. If you send us your existing data we can evaluate it and provide
you a quote on the conversion cost.
EntryMate™
Enter your whole library or
finish the entry process by simply scanning in (or manually recording)
a list of
ISBN's
that can be processed
by us for $125 per 1,000 items. This can speed up the cataloguing of a
new library tremendously! For users of the Regular version of ResourceMateŽ,
the resulting cataloguing data can be merged into your existing database
for $60. ResourceMateŽ Plus users have a new feature to allow this data
to be imported and merged at no extra cost.
To make the ISBN recording
process easier, we offer a hand-held portable scanner for rent by the
week. You can go from shelf to shelf scanning in your items' ISBN barcodes
on this handy unit. You can also use the unit to manually record ISBN's
for those items without an ISBN barcode.
ResourceMateŽ Plus
users who make use of ResourceMateŽ's Import from Internet
feature (see below), can now use EntryMate™ to process a file of
accumulated Library of Congress records. This is great if the library
computer does not have access to the Internet. Your volunteers can accumulate
a file of LOC records and those records can be merged en masse.

Import from Internet / ISBN
Retrieval
This popular feature allows
you to find full cataloguing information using the free Library of Congress
(LOC) Z39.50 web site (www.loc.gov/z3950).
Search for an item, copy the entire LOC cataloguing record to the Windows™
clipboard in one motion and have that information automatically entered
into the appropriate fields in ResourceMateŽ! You can even make changes
to the imported data before it is added to the database. Import from Internet
can increase your entry speed five times. Import from Internet can also
be used with EntryMate™ in the Plus version
(see above).
With ISBN Retrieval (available to registered users with support), enter
the isbn number and click on the ISBN Retrieval button. If you have an
internet connection, the Library of Congress will be searched, otherwise
a local table will be searched.
Import from MARC
ResourceMateŽ Plus
users can import one or more files containing MARC records. Your book
supplier may have given you a MARC database of your items or you may have
data that has been exported from another library system in MARC format.
You can import this data into ResourceMateŽ. There are many MARC format
variants. Check with us to ensure your MARC records are in a compatible
format.
